On 06/08/2013 04:10 AM, Sergei Shtylyov wrote:
> Hello.
>
> On 06/08/2013 03:51 AM, Sergei Shtylyov wrote:
>
>>     This series of 9 patches are against Dave's 'net-next.git' 
>> repository.
>>     The series deals with the #ifdef'fery around SoC support 
>> code/data in the
>> 'sh_eth' driver. It doesn't yet get rid of all the #ifdef's: 3 are 
>> left, 1 of
>> them still hinders ARM multiplatform build -- I'll try to deal with 
>> it next
>> week.
>>
>> [1/9] sh_eth: create initial ID table
>> [2/9] sh_eth: get SH771x support out of #ifdef
>> [3/9] sh_eth: get SH7619 support out of #ifdef
>> [4/9] sh_eth: get R8A7740 support out of #ifdef
>> [5/9] sh_eth: get SH77{34|63} support out of #ifdef
>> [6/9] sh_eth: get SH7757 support out of #ifdef
>> [7/9] sh_eth: get SH7724 support out of #ifdef
>> [8/9] sh_eth: get R8A777x support out of #ifdef
>> [9/9] sh_eth: remove dependencies from Kconfig
>>
>
>    Sorry, Paul, forgot to include you into the CC list on most of the 
> patches
> and the cover letter. Please look for the patches on linux-sh and ACK 
> them
> if you deem necessary.

    Also, forgot to CC Simon, Magnus, Russell and LAKML on some patches.
Too much haste, forgot to run scripts/get_maintainer.pl before sending 
out patches...

WBR, Sergei

    Hold on please. It just occured to me that the series won't be 
bisectable on anything but R-Car CPUs (I checked it only on R8A7779) 
since I forgot that 'sh_eth_my_cpu_data' variable should be always 
available in any configuuration until the last patch (so the patch #1 is 
somewhat incomplete). I'll respin the series today and resend.

WBR, Sergei
